Jay Manuel and Jay Alexander

      *The CW network has ordered a pilot for "Operation Fabulous," a spinoff to its popular reality series "America's Next Top Model" that would star the show's standout fashion experts Jay Manuel and J. Alexander.       

       Executive produced by "Top Model" chiefs Tyra Banks and Ken Mok, "Fabulous" will have the two "Jays" travel the country giving women makeovers.      

       Jay Manuel tells E! Online that each episode will feature five women from one town who get fashion overhauls and compete until one of them is singled out as the winner from that town. From there, the winners from each town will go on to compete in a "bigger competition," and in the end, that final winner will get a makeover...for their hometown.

       Manuel also tells E! Online the series should not be referred to as a "spinoff," stating: "I can definitely say that. This is a new series that is a separate world from 'Model' and will really help women try to elevate their lives."

       As for "Top Model," Manuel says they will remain with the series, which already has a contractual pickup for three more seasons. Manuel is the creative director of the show's photo shoots; Alexander is a runway expert who has been a judge for the past few seasons.

       "Model" airs twice a year on the CW. Although ratings have dropped in recent years, the reality show remains the network's highest-rated series.      

       "Fabulous" would mark the third fashion-themed reality series on CW from Banks and Mok, who also executive produce the network's series "Stylista," slated to debut Oct. 22, which features contestants vying for an editorial position at Elle magazine.
